Welcome to the Gagliarchives forum!

As you've seen, the Gagliarchives is now being rebroadcast at Aural Moon (Wednesdays from 2-6pm CDT, perhaps other times). Use this forum to talk about this week's, or other shows. Tell Tom what you think, what you want to see in future shows, and what past shows, interviews or segments you might want to hear on Aural Moon.
